Phoenix Contact MINIMCR2UNIUI2UIPT 4-Way Signal Duplicator

The PHOENIX CONTACT MINI MCR-2-UNI-UI-2UI-PT is a versatile 4-way signal duplicator designed for industrial automation and control systems. It provides a solution for replicating analog signals while maintaining electrical isolation, crucial for protecting sensitive equipment and ensuring signal integrity. The device's configurable nature, accessible through both DIP switches and software, allows for adaptability to diverse application requirements. Its plug-in connection technology simplifies installation and maintenance. Typical applications include process monitoring, data acquisition, and distributed control systems where signal duplication and isolation are essential.

Phoenix Contact MINIMCR2UNIUI2UIPT 4-Way Signal Duplicator Specifications:

  • packing_unit: 1 STK
  • gtin: 4046356915250
  • weight_per_piece: 120.000 g
  • custom_tariff_number: 85437090
  • country_of_origin: Germany
  • width: 6.2 mm
  • height: 110.5 mm
  • depth: 120.5 mm
  • ambient_temperature_operation: -40 °C ... 70 °C
  • ambient_temperature_storage: -40 °C ... 85 °C
  • degree_of_protection: IP20
  • number_of_inputs: 1
  • configurable_programmable: Yes
  • voltage_input_signal: 0 V ... 10 V (via DIP switch)
  • voltage_input_signal_2: 2 V ... 10 V (via DIP switch)
  • voltage_input_signal_3: 0 V ... 5 V (via DIP switch)
  • voltage_input_signal_4: 1 V ... 5 V (via DIP switch)
  • voltage_input_signal_software: 0 V ... 12 V (Can be set via software)
  • current_input_signal: 0 mA ... 20 mA (via DIP switch)
  • current_input_signal_2: 4 mA ... 20 mA (via DIP switch)
  • current_input_signal_3: 0 mA ... 10 mA (via DIP switch)
  • current_input_signal_4: 20 mA ... 0 mA (via DIP switch)
  • current_input_signal_software: 0 mA ... 24 mA (Can be set via software)
  • max_input_voltage: 12 V
  • max_input_current: 24 mA
  • input_resistance_voltage: > 120 kΩ
  • input_resistance_current: approx. 50 Ω (+ 0.7 V for test diode)
  • number_of_outputs: 2
  • voltage_output_signal: 0 V ... 10 V (via DIP switch)
  • voltage_output_signal_2: 2 V ... 10 V (via DIP switch)
  • voltage_output_signal_3: 0 V ... 5 V (via DIP switch)
  • voltage_output_signal_4: 1 V ... 5 V (via DIP switch)
  • voltage_output_signal_software: 0 V ... 10.5 V (Can be set via software)
  • current_output_signal: 0 mA ... 20 mA (via DIP switch)
  • current_output_signal_2: 4 mA ... 20 mA (via DIP switch)
  • current_output_signal_3: 0 mA ... 10 mA (via DIP switch)
  • current_output_signal_4: 20 mA ... 0 mA (via DIP switch)
  • current_output_signal_software: 0 mA ... 21 mA (Can be set via software)
  • max_output_voltage: approx. 12.3 V
  • max_output_current: 24.6 mA
  • short_circuit_current: ≤ 25 mA
  • load_output_load_voltage: ≥ 10 kΩ
  • load_output_load_current: ≤ 600 Ω (per channel)
  • ripple: < 20 mVPP(at 600 Ω)
  • nominal_supply_voltage: 24 V DC
  • supply_voltage_range: 9.6 V DC ... 30 V DC
  • typical_current_consumption: 55 mA (24 V DC)
  • typical_current_consumption_2: 110 mA (12 V DC)
  • power_consumption: 1.5 W (at IOUT= 20 mA, 9.6 V DC, 600 Ω load)
  • connection_method: Push-in connection
  • min_conductor_size_solid: 0.14 mm²
  • max_conductor_size_solid: 2.5 mm²
  • min_conductor_size_flexible: 0.14 mm²
  • max_conductor_size_flexible: 2.5 mm²
  • min_awg_flexible: 24
  • max_awg_flexible: 12
  • stripping_length: 10 mm
  • maximum_transmission_error: 0.1 % (of final value)
  • maximum_temperature_coefficient: 0.01 %/K
  • step_response: approx. 140 ms (15 Hz sample rate)
  • step_response_2: approx. 45 ms (60 Hz sample rate)
  • step_response_3: approx. 25 ms (240 Hz sample rate)
  • electrical_isolation: Reinforced insulation in accordance with IEC 61010-1
  • overvoltage_category: II
  • degree_of_pollution: 2
  • rated_insulation_voltage: 300 V
  • test_voltage: 3 kV (50 Hz, 1 min.)
  • noise_emission: EN 61000-6-4
  • noise_immunity: EN 61000-6-2
  • housing_material: PBT
  • mounting_position: any
  • emc_field: 0.2 %
  • transients: 0.1 %
  • conducted_interference: 2.8 %
